Output 6ffda72f414b4bd4cb313222e9e34ef4ecbee55ce6f53be4b33f185eb54aa990:0

value
4305783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d66b58bc897cdb947648de539305d0eb97aa4e8 OP_EQUAL
address
3JxUgA6DQ85wLeTyqeuG4F5w4bnBYXFzNq
transaction
6ffda72f414b4bd4cb313222e9e34ef4ecbee55ce6f53be4b33f185eb54aa990
spent
true